How hard is it to get into State University of New York at Plattsburgh?

With a 78.4% acceptance rate, State University of New York at Plattsburgh is accessibleadmits a majority of applicants. It enrolls roughly 3,769 undergraduates (small town setting) in Plattsburgh, NY. Solid grades, a sensible test plan, and thoughtful essays go a long way here.

What it takes to get in

  • SAT: admitted students land around 1080–1250 (middle 50%). Aim for the upper end to be competitive.
  • ACT: the middle 50% is about 22–28.
  • Testing policy: Test required. Confirm on the school's site, since policies shift each cycle.
  • Essays: at State University of New York at Plattsburgh's selectivity, the application essays are often what separates similar applicants. Make them specific and authentically yours.

Cost

Published tuition is about $18,945 out-of-state ($9,035 in-state) per year before aid. Many students pay less after financial aid — check the school's net price calculator.
